别把域名当服务器:www与底层硬件的真实关系
很多非技术人员在提及“网站服务器”和“www”时,往往会混为一谈。例如,有人会问:“我的www怎么打不开了?”——这本身就是一种认知错位。www只是互联网服务的一个子域名,通常是World Wide Web的缩写,而网站服务器则是一台或多台运行着Web Server软件(如Nginx、Apache、IIS)的物理机或虚拟机。2026年的今天,虽然CDN和边缘计算已经极大模糊了“服务器”的地理概念,但www与服务器之间的区别依然是站长必须厘清的第一道防线。简单说,www是门牌号(指向),服务器是房子本身(承载内容)。如果服务器宕机,www自然指向空房子;如果DNS解析出错,即便服务器健康,www也可能指向错误的位置。
服务器失去响应:不只是“死机”那么简单
当网站服务器失去响应,站长后台看到的状态码可能是502 Bad Gateway,也可能是504 Gateway Timeout,甚至是完全无反应的空白页。2026年上半年的多家云服务商故障报告显示,约63%的“失去响应”事件并非硬件故障,而是软件层面的连锁崩溃。例如,PHP-FPM进程数耗尽、MySQL连接池打满、或者Redis缓存穿透导致后端数据库瞬间过载。典型的场景是:某个促销活动页面突发海量请求,应用层无法及时释放连接,最终导致Nginx反向代理等待超时,直接向用户端抛出“服务器失去响应”的提示。更隐蔽的原因是2026年大火的Serverless架构中,冷启动延迟在某些低并发场景下被误报为服务不可用。因此,排查时不应先怀疑硬件,而应优先检查应用日志、进程健康状态以及云监控API的限流阈值。
服务器配置避坑:那些省小钱吃大亏的决策
服务器配置踩坑,往往是新站建设中最隐蔽的成本黑洞。以下三个典型失误在2026年的中小企业建站案例中反复出现:
内存与带宽的失衡
不少站长倾向于选择低内存(如1GB RAM)但高带宽的入门套餐,以为流量大就够用。实际上,对于动态语言编写的站点(如WordPress、ThinkPHP),1GB内存连基础数据库缓存都跑不起来,一旦遇到爬虫或并发请求,直接触发OOM Killer,导致MySQL进程被系统强制kill。2026年主流云厂商的推荐配置是至少4GB RAM起步,并搭配对象存储分离静态资源。
IOPS与磁盘类型的误判
2025年至今,NVMe SSD已全面普及,但仍有用户为了省几十块钱选择高性能云盘(其实是HDD模拟)。当网站写入日志频繁或数据库产生大量随机读写时,磁盘IOPS成为瓶颈,服务器响应时间剧烈波动。一个很典型的信号是:普通页面打开很快,但涉及数据查询的页面(如用户中心、产品详情)极慢,这时候八成是磁盘性能受限。
忽略os版本与软件兼容性
2026年,AlmaLinux 9和Debian 12已成为主流,但不少公开教程仍建议CentOS 7(已EOL)。使用过时操作系统跑新版本的PHP 8.3或Node.js 20,轻则出现函数不兼容,重则因为缺少安全补丁被扫描到0-day漏洞。配置前务必将操作系统更新至厂商长期维护版本。
网站太慢:被限流还是资源耗尽?
网站速度变慢时,不少人第一反应是“服务器被限制带宽或恶意攻击了”。这种猜测有其合理性,但并不全面。2026年,大多数主流IDC和云厂商提供的基础带宽保障在5Mbps以上,一般的中小站点在非活动期很难被带宽限速压垮。真正的“慢”往往源于以下三个层级:
应用层瓶颈
数据库查询未优化、未启用Redis或Memcached缓存、模板引擎每次请求都重新编译——这些都是导致页面生成时间超过3秒的常见原因。2026年的一个典型数据是,启用全页面静态缓存后,首屏加载时间能从4.2秒降至0.7秒,降幅近84%。
网络层“假拥堵”
部分CDN节点在回源时选择了非最优路径,或者源站和CDN之间的区域网络专线出现丢包。这种问题常表现为“白天正常,晚上慢”,因为晚间跨运营商流量激增。解决方法是配置多运营商BGP线路或启用智能DNS调度。
被限流或误识别
服务器层面确实存在被限流的可能,典型场景是云服务商的安全组策略对某些IP段做了并发限制,或者WAF(Web应用防火墙)将正常爬虫识别为攻击导致频繁验证。2026年6月初,曾有某电商站点因为WAF规则误封了百度蜘蛛,导致搜索引擎收录断崖式下降,站长误以为是服务器响应慢。排查手段是检查云服务商的控制台流量报表,观察有无突增的拒绝记录。
服务器错误代码:从400到503的生存解读
当用户看到“服务器错误”提示时,实际上背后对应着具体的HTTP状态码。不同错误码对应完全不同的运维方向:
- 400 Bad Request:客户端请求语法错误,常见于表单提交时字符编码不正确或JSON格式损坏。2026年因为前端框架升级导致请求Header过大引发400的案例增多,需检查代理服务器的client_max_body_size配置。
- 401/403 Forbidden:权限不足。可能原因:目录权限设置导致禁止访问,或者Nginx的allow/deny规则误将合法IP列入黑名单。
- 404 Not Found:URL重写规则失误或文件被误删。2026年伪静态配置中因nginx重写规则正则错误导致404的求助帖占比高达21%。
- 500 Internal Server Error:通用服务器端错误。根本排查法:查看php-fpm日志或应用框架的error log。通常由PHP代码异常、文件写入权限不足或PHP扩展未正确加载引起。
- 502 Bad Gateway:上游服务器无响应。典型场景:Nginx反向代理后端的PHP-FPM服务挂掉,或者PHP-FPM的进程池耗尽。
- 503 Service Unavailable:服务器临时过载或正在维护。2026年很多云厂商提供弹性伸缩,但冷启动期间容易短暂出现503。如果持续出现,检查服务健康检查是否配置正确。
理解这些错误码的本质,有助于站长从恐慌转向精准排障。2026年的运维趋势是智能化监控,但底层原理依然没有变——大脑里没有这张映射表,再好的工具也只能提供告警,无法帮你定位原因。